    Hey Thanks..I have a 1963 5 dollar red stamp star note,need help to know if its worth any more than face value.Love the videos,keep them going!...K.C.C>o...keep kalm and coin on...

    • @currencyworld
      @currencyworld  6 ปีที่แล้ว +1

      Thanks. I appreciate the support and I like your motto. The 1963 $5 red seals are not usually worth a lot over face value as they are very common. You could probably get a few dollars over face value for a note in average condition. If the note is uncirculated it could be worth 4-5 times face value. I would hold on to it as it is a cool note. I hope that helps.
